According to the public record, 31, Lower Queen Street, Sutton Coldfield is a modern leasehold apartment with 548 ft2 of internal area.
Apartments of this size in this area normally have 2 bedrooms.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 31, Lower Queen Street, Sutton Coldfield is £134,794 and the estimated rental value is £996 per month.
Lower Queen Street, Sutton Coldfield, B72 is located in the borough of Birmingham within the B72 postal district.
31, Lower Queen Street, Sutton Coldfield has a single entry in the Land Registry from December 2024 and a single entry in the EPC database dated January 2024.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 31, Lower Queen Street, Sutton Coldfield is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£141,534 and a rental value of £1,046 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£125,358 and a rental value of £926 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 31 Lower Queen Street Sutton Coldfield has increased by an estimated £32 (0.0%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£18 per month (1.8%), giving an expected gross yield of 8.9%.
31, Lower Queen Street, Sutton Coldfield has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 22 Jan 2024.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Electric storage heaters.
According to HM Land Registry, 31, Lower Queen Street, Sutton Coldfield was last sold on 12th December 2024 for £125,000 and was recorded as a leasehold flat.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
